New Jersey Statutes
§ 45:14C-16 — Examinations; fees
New Jersey·Title 45 PROFESSIONS AND OCCUPATIONS
(a)Every State master plumber's license examination shall be substantially uniform and shall be designed so as to establish the competence and qualifications of the applicant to perform the type of work and business as described by this act. The examination may be theoretical or practical in nature, or both.
(b)The examination shall be held at least 4 times a year, at Trenton or such other place as the State board shall deem necessary. Public notice of the time and place of the examination shall be given.
(c)No person who has failed the examination shall be eligible to be reexamined for a period of 6 months from the date of the examination failed by such person.
(d)The following shall be the fees charged by the State board: First application for master plumber's license .......... $100
